@import"https://fonts.googleapis.com/css2?family=Inter:ital,opsz,wght@0,14..32,100..900;1,14..32,100..900&display=swap";*{margin:0;font-family:Inter}body{background-color:#232323}._siteStructureCont_1mbgn_9{width:98%;height:auto;display:grid;grid-template-rows:auto 1fr;max-width:1440px;margin:0 auto;display:flex;flex-direction:column;gap:40px;box-sizing:border-box;padding:10px}._imgCLS_57j02_1{width:100%;height:100%}@media screen and (min-width: 0px) and (max-width: 500px){._linkOuter_57j02_6{width:70px!important}@media screen and (max-width: 250px){._linkOuter_57j02_6{width:50px!important}}}._navContainer_1eobh_1{width:100%;height:auto;display:flex;align-items:center;justify-content:center;position:relative}._mobileBTN_1eobh_9{position:absolute;top:50%;right:0;transform:translateY(-50%);z-index:2;border:none;background:transparent;cursor:pointer}._mobileIMG_1eobh_19{width:100%;height:100%}@media screen and (min-width: 0px) and (max-width: 500px){@media screen and (max-width: 250px){._mobileBTN_1eobh_9{width:50px}}}._footerWrapper_eji90_1{background:#000;color:#fff;border-radius:20px;display:grid;grid-template-rows:1fr auto;gap:30px;text-align:center;box-sizing:border-box;padding:50px 30px 20px}._footerContent_eji90_13{display:flex;flex-direction:column;gap:20px}._footerHeader_eji90_18{text-transform:uppercase;font-size:4.5em;font-weight:700}._contactEmail_eji90_23{text-decoration:none;color:#fff;font-size:2.5em;font-weight:400}._socialsCopyright_eji90_29{width:100%;height:auto;display:flex;justify-content:space-between;align-items:center}._socialsFlex_eji90_36{display:flex;align-items:center;gap:20px}._socialLogo_eji90_41{width:40px;height:auto;aspect-ratio:1 / 1;transition:.3s ease-in-out}._socialLogo_eji90_41:hover,._socialLogo_eji90_41:active{filter:brightness(.8)}._socialLogoIMG_eji90_51{width:100%;height:100%}._signature_eji90_55{color:#79b9ff;text-decoration:none}@media screen and (min-width: 0px) and (max-width: 900px){._footerWrapper_eji90_1{text-align:left}._contactEmail_eji90_23{font-size:1.25em}._socialsCopyright_eji90_29{flex-direction:column;align-items:flex-start}@media screen and (max-width: 375px){._footerHeader_eji90_18,._contactEmail_eji90_23{font-size:1em}}@media screen and (max-width: 288px){._contactEmail_eji90_23{font-size:.8em}}}._mainHome_1f3v1_1{display:flex;flex-direction:column;gap:40px}._moldText_1f3v1_6{color:#fff;font-weight:800;font-size:1.75em}._ctaHero_1f3v1_11{width:fit-content;border-radius:20px;padding:24px 36px;background-color:#b22222;color:#fff;border:none;font-weight:600;font-size:1.05em;transition:.3s ease-in-out;cursor:pointer;text-decoration:none}._ctaHero_1f3v1_11:hover,._ctaHero_1f3v1_11:active{filter:brightness(.8)}._header_1f3v1_28{font-size:3.5em;white-space:pre-line}._subtext_1f3v1_32{color:silver;font-size:1.1em;width:55%}@media screen and (min-width: 0px) and (max-width: 500px){._header_1f3v1_28{font-size:2em}._subtext_1f3v1_32{font-size:1.2em;width:100%}._moldText_1f3v1_6{font-size:1em}}._heroCont_1fu50_1{width:100%;min-height:800px;border-radius:20px;background-size:cover;background-position:center;box-sizing:border-box;padding:20px;text-align:left;display:grid;grid-template-rows:auto 1fr}._heroContent_1fu50_13{width:100%;height:100%;display:flex;flex-direction:column;gap:60px;justify-content:center;color:#fff}@media screen and (min-width: 0px) and (max-width: 500px){._heroCont_1fu50_1{text-align:center}._heroContent_1fu50_13{align-items:center}}@keyframes _slide_1xuol_1{0%{transform:translate(0)}to{transform:translate(-100%)}}@keyframes _slide2_1xuol_1{0%{transform:translate(-100%)}to{transform:translate(0)}}._logos_1xuol_17{overflow:hidden;padding:40px 0;position:relative;display:flex;gap:100px}._logos_1xuol_17:before,._logos_1xuol_17:after{position:absolute;top:0;width:250px;height:100%;content:"";z-index:2}._logos_1xuol_17:before{left:0;background:linear-gradient(to left,#f4f4f200,#232323)}._logos_1xuol_17:after{right:0;background:linear-gradient(to right,#f4f4f200,#232323)}._logosSlide_1xuol_43{animation:15s _slide_1xuol_1 infinite linear;display:inline-block;display:flex;gap:150px}._logos-slide_1xuol_49 img{height:50px;margin:0 40px;filter:grayscale(100%)}@media screen and (min-width: 0px) and (max-width: 1250px){._logos_1xuol_17:before,._logos_1xuol_17:after{position:absolute;top:0;width:100px;height:100%;content:"";z-index:2}}@media screen and (min-width: 0px) and (max-width: 500px){._logosSlide_1xuol_43{gap:0}}@keyframes slide{0%{transform:translate(0)}to{transform:translate(-100%)}}@keyframes slide2{0%{transform:translate(-100%)}to{transform:translate(0)}}._aboutWrapper_19uj6_1{display:grid;grid-template-rows:auto 1fr;gap:25px;text-align:center;color:#fff}._evenlyCont_19uj6_8{display:flex;flex-direction:column;align-items:center;justify-content:space-evenly;gap:20px}._aboutHeader_19uj6_15{font-size:2.75em;font-weight:600}._rect_19uj6_19{width:20%;height:5px;background:#b22222}._aboutSub_19uj6_24{width:90%}._photoGrid_19uj6_27{width:90%;margin:0 auto;position:relative;display:grid;grid-template-columns:repeat(3,1fr);gap:20px}._photoGrid_19uj6_27:before{content:"";position:absolute;width:110%;height:100px;background:#b22222;top:50%;left:-5%;transform:translateY(-50%);z-index:-1}._photoGridTemp_19uj6_46{width:100%;height:100%;object-fit:cover}@media screen and (min-width: 0px) and (max-width: 500px){._photoGrid_19uj6_27{grid-template-columns:1fr}._photoGridTemp_19uj6_46{max-height:300px;object-fit:contain}}._servicesWrapper_1m7i6_1{color:#fff;display:grid;grid-template-rows:auto 1fr;gap:60px}._exploreSer_1m7i6_7{font-size:2.25em}._servicesGrid_1m7i6_10{display:grid;grid-template-columns:repeat(6,1fr);gap:20px;align-items:stretch}._serviceTempl_1m7i6_16{display:grid;grid-template-rows:auto 1fr auto;padding:20px 10px;background:#3a3a3a;border:2px solid transparent;border-radius:10px;gap:30px}._active_1m7i6_25{border:2px solid #b22222}._indicator_1m7i6_28{width:fit-content;display:flex;align-items:center;justify-content:center;font-size:1.75em;border-radius:10px;background-color:#b22222;padding:10px;aspect-ratio:1 / 1}._flexCont_1m7i6_39{display:flex;justify-content:flex-end;width:100%}._contentGap_1m7i6_44{display:flex;flex-direction:column;gap:15px}._arrows_1m7i6_49{color:#fff;text-decoration:none;font-size:2em;transition:.3s ease-in-out;position:relative;bottom:0;right:0}._arrows_1m7i6_49:hover,._arrows_1m7i6_49:active{filter:brightness(.8)}._name_1m7i6_62{font-size:1.15em;font-weight:700}._subtext_1m7i6_66{font-size:1.1em}@media screen and (min-width: 0px) and (max-width: 900px){._servicesGrid_1m7i6_10{grid-template-columns:1fr}}._customersWrapper_gs4s8_1{color:#fff;text-align:center;display:grid;grid-template-rows:auto 1fr;gap:20px}._customerWord_gs4s8_8{font-size:2.5em;width:60%;margin:0 auto;white-space:pre-line}._custRows_gs4s8_14{display:grid;grid-template-rows:repeat(2,1fr);gap:30px}._rowOne_gs4s8_19,._rowTwo_gs4s8_20{display:flex;align-items:center;justify-content:space-between;align-items:stretch;gap:30px}._reviewCont_gs4s8_27{background:#3a3a3a;min-width:264px;height:auto;border-radius:10px;box-sizing:border-box;padding:20px;display:flex;flex-direction:column;gap:10px}@media screen and (min-width: 0px) and (max-width: 500px){._customerWord_gs4s8_8{font-size:1em}._reviewCont_gs4s8_27{min-width:0}}._benefitWrapper_u7qb1_1{width:100%;height:auto;display:grid;grid-template-rows:auto 1fr;gap:15px;color:#fff}._flexClm_u7qb1_9{display:flex;flex-direction:column;align-items:flex-end;text-align:right;gap:10px}._benefitHeader_u7qb1_17{font-size:2.5em}._benefitSubtext_u7qb1_20{width:80%;font-size:1.15em}._benefitRowGrid_u7qb1_24{display:grid;gap:20px}._benefitTemplate_u7qb1_28{width:100%;height:auto;border-radius:10px;border:1px solid #b22222;box-sizing:border-box;padding:20px;display:flex;align-items:center;gap:20px}._iconWrapper_u7qb1_39{background:#b22222;display:flex;align-items:center;justify-content:center;padding:10px;aspect-ratio:1 / 1;border-radius:100%;width:80px}._benefitIMGS_u7qb1_49{width:80%;height:auto;aspect-ratio:1 / 1}._flexClm2_u7qb1_54{display:flex;flex-direction:column;gap:10px}._flexClm2_u7qb1_54 h6{font-size:2em}._flexClm2_u7qb1_54 p{font-size:1.25em;width:95%}@media screen and (min-width: 0px) and (max-width: 500px){._iconWrapper_u7qb1_39{width:50px}._benefitIMGS_u7qb1_49{width:100%}@media screen and (max-width: 425px){._benefitTemplate_u7qb1_28{flex-direction:column;align-items:flex-start}}}._mobileDiv_c03w6_1{position:fixed;width:100%;height:100vh;top:0;left:0;z-index:100;opacity:0;pointer-events:none;margin:0;display:flex;align-items:center;justify-content:center;flex-direction:column;transition:.8s ease-in-out;gap:20px}._mobileDiv_c03w6_1._active_c03w6_19{opacity:1;pointer-events:auto;background-color:#b22222}._mobileDiv_c03w6_1 a{color:#fff;text-decoration:none;font-size:2em;font-weight:700;border-bottom:2px solid transparent;transition:.3s ease-in-out}._mobileDiv_c03w6_1 a:hover,._mobileDiv_c03w6_1 a:active{border-bottom:2px solid white}._closeMenu_c03w6_36{color:#fff;background-color:transparent;border:none;position:absolute;top:5%;right:5%;font-size:3em;cursor:pointer;transition:.3s ease-in-out}._closeMenu_c03w6_36:active,._closeMenu_c03w6_36:hover{filter:brightness(.8)}._mobileLogo_c03w6_51{width:50px}.react-calendar{width:350px;max-width:100%;background:#fff;border:1px solid #a0a096;font-family:Arial,Helvetica,sans-serif;line-height:1.125em}.react-calendar--doubleView{width:700px}.react-calendar--doubleView .react-calendar__viewContainer{display:flex;margin:-.5em}.react-calendar--doubleView .react-calendar__viewContainer>*{width:50%;margin:.5em}.react-calendar,.react-calendar *,.react-calendar *:before,.react-calendar *:after{-moz-box-sizing:border-box;-webkit-box-sizing:border-box;box-sizing:border-box}.react-calendar button{margin:0;border:0;outline:none}.react-calendar button:enabled:hover{cursor:pointer}.react-calendar__navigation{display:flex;height:44px;margin-bottom:1em}.react-calendar__navigation button{min-width:44px;background:none}.react-calendar__navigation button:disabled{background-color:#f0f0f0}.react-calendar__navigation button:enabled:hover,.react-calendar__navigation button:enabled:focus{background-color:#e6e6e6}.react-calendar__month-view__weekdays{text-align:center;text-transform:uppercase;font:inherit;font-size:.75em;font-weight:700}.react-calendar__month-view__weekdays__weekday{padding:.5em}.react-calendar__month-view__weekNumbers .react-calendar__tile{display:flex;align-items:center;justify-content:center;font:inherit;font-size:.75em;font-weight:700}.react-calendar__month-view__days__day--weekend{color:#d10000}.react-calendar__month-view__days__day--neighboringMonth,.react-calendar__decade-view__years__year--neighboringDecade,.react-calendar__century-view__decades__decade--neighboringCentury{color:#757575}.react-calendar__year-view .react-calendar__tile,.react-calendar__decade-view .react-calendar__tile,.react-calendar__century-view .react-calendar__tile{padding:2em .5em}.react-calendar__tile{max-width:100%;padding:10px 6.6667px;background:none;text-align:center;font:inherit;font-size:.833em}.react-calendar__tile:disabled{background-color:#f0f0f0;color:#ababab}.react-calendar__month-view__days__day--neighboringMonth:disabled,.react-calendar__decade-view__years__year--neighboringDecade:disabled,.react-calendar__century-view__decades__decade--neighboringCentury:disabled{color:#cdcdcd}.react-calendar__tile:enabled:hover,.react-calendar__tile:enabled:focus{background-color:#e6e6e6}.react-calendar__tile--now{background:#ffff76}.react-calendar__tile--now:enabled:hover,.react-calendar__tile--now:enabled:focus{background:#ffffa9}.react-calendar__tile--hasActive{background:#76baff}.react-calendar__tile--hasActive:enabled:hover,.react-calendar__tile--hasActive:enabled:focus{background:#a9d4ff}.react-calendar__tile--active{background:#006edc;color:#fff}.react-calendar__tile--active:enabled:hover,.react-calendar__tile--active:enabled:focus{background:#1087ff}.react-calendar--selectRange .react-calendar__tile--hover{background-color:#e6e6e6}.react-calendar{width:100%;border:none}.react-calendar__tile{transition:.3s ease-in-out}.react-calendar__tile--now{background-color:#fff;color:#000}.react-calendar__tile--now:hover{background-color:#e6e6e6!important}.react-calendar__tile--active,.react-calendar__tile--now--active{background:#b22222!important;color:#fff}._bookingWrap_1qahs_1{display:flex;flex-direction:column;gap:40px}._bookingGrid_1qahs_6{width:100%;height:100%;display:grid;grid-template-columns:repeat(2,1fr);gap:5%}._bookingLeft_1qahs_13{display:flex;flex-direction:column;gap:40px}._bookingLeft_1qahs_13 h1{font-size:3em}._bookingLeft_1qahs_13 p{font-size:2em;width:80%;color:silver}._bookingRight_1qahs_26{background-color:#fff;border-radius:20px;box-sizing:border-box;color:#000;padding:30px;display:flex;flex-direction:column;gap:20px;overflow-y:scroll;max-height:650px}._flexClm_1qahs_38{display:flex;flex-direction:column;gap:10px}._labels_1qahs_43{font-size:1.5em;font-weight:600}._inputField_1qahs_47{box-sizing:border-box;padding:10px;border-radius:10px;border:1px solid black}._inputField_1qahs_47::placeholder{color:silver}._paymentProcess_1qahs_56{width:fit-content;font-size:1.25em;padding:10px 15px;box-sizing:border-box;border-radius:10px;background:#b22222;color:#fff;font-weight:600;border:none;cursor:pointer;transition:.3s ease-in-out}._paymentProcess_1qahs_56:hover,._paymentProcess_1qahs_56:active{filter:brightness(.9)}@media screen and (min-width: 0px) and (max-width: 900px){._bookingGrid_1qahs_6{grid-template-columns:1fr}._bookingLeft_1qahs_13{align-items:center}._flexClm_1qahs_38{align-items:flex-start}._inputField_1qahs_47{width:100%}}._successWrapper_1hxwi_1{display:flex;flex-direction:column;gap:40px}._successWrapper_1hxwi_1 h1{font-size:2.25em}._successWrapper_1hxwi_1 p{font-size:1.5em}._back_1hxwi_12{text-decoration:none;color:#fff;background:#b22222;width:fit-content;padding:10px 15px;border-radius:10px;transition:.3s ease-in-out;cursor:pointer}._back_1hxwi_12:hover,._back_1hxwi_12:active{filter:brightness(.9)}@media screen and (min-width: 0px) and (max-width: 500px){._successWrapper_1hxwi_1{align-items:center}}
